Langostino is a Spanish word with different meanings in different areas. In the United States, it is commonly used in the restaurant trade to refer to the meat of the squat lobster, which is neither a true lobster nor a prawn. Squat lobsters are more closely related to porcelain and hermit crabs.

What Is Langostino Used For? Langostino is often used for several different types of seafood dishes. This is a bold shellfish that can be enjoyed on its own, or when combined with other types of seafood. It has a sweet, delicate flavor that lends itself well to other bold sauces. Tomato based sauces are a popular choice, served alongside pasta.

Actually, langostino is Spanish for “little lobster.”. Although langostino’s taste and texture are similar to lobster meat, langostino is not the crustacean Americans typically refer to as “lobster” — American, or Maine, lobster and spiny lobster. The langostino debate is nothing new.
